Ryanair’S low fares come to Preveza Aktion

Aktion Airport

Flights to Budapest from July 2019.

Ryanair announced its first ever flights from Preveza Aktion Airport, its newest airport and its 14th Greek airport, with a new weekly route to Budapest commencing in July, as part of its Summer 2019 schedule.

Preveza consumers and visitors can now book their holidays as far out as 30 September 2019, enjoying even lower fares and Ryanair’s recently announced 2019 customer care improvements, including:

  • Lowest Fares – find a cheaper fare within 3 hours, get paid the difference plus €5 MyRyanair credit
  • Punctuality – deliver 90% target (excl. ATC) or 5% off following month’s air fares
  • Customer Care Charter – EU261 claims processed in 10 days, new 24/7 support, connect in 2 mins
  • Care Improvements – 48-hour free of charge grace period for changes to bookings
  • Environmental Improvements – carbon offset programme, environmental partners & plastic free in 5 years
  • New Ryanair Choice – €199 annual fee for free seats, fast-track & priority boarding for freq. guests
  • Digital Improvements – new fare finder, sports tickets, bespoke travel guides & faster mobile

Ryanair’s Chiara Ravara said: “We’re pleased to announce Ryanair’s low fares have arrived at Preveza Aktion, our newest airport and 14th in Greece. Our new route to Budapest commences in July 2019 and will operate weekly for Summer 2019, ensuring customers in Preveza can book low fare flights to Budapest as far out as 30 September 2019.
